Is 15k elo good in CS2?

Yes, 15k Elo in CS2 is considered good and above average, placing you in the top 15-20% of players, a "Skilled Minority" in the purple rank, meaning you understand fundamentals but might struggle with consistency or higher-level strategy compared to elite players. It's a respectable rating showing solid gameplay, but not yet elite territory (20k+), with players often needing better teamwork or utility usage to climb further.

How good is 15k in CS2?

Blue (10,000-14,999): Above-average players with solid fundamentals. Purple (15,000-19,999): Skilled players with advanced game knowledge. Pink (20,000-24,999): Elite players approaching professional level. Red (25,000-29,999): Top-tier players with exceptional skills.

What is a good ELO in CS2?

What CS2 Rank is Good? If you are between anything above 12,500 CS2 rating places you above average, though whether you determine that to be "good" or not is up to you. At 13k ELO, you are in the top 45%, at 14k you are in the top 37%, and at 20k you are in the top 4% of players.

What is the average CS2 rank?

The average CS2 rank in Premier mode typically falls in the 10,000 to 12,000 CS Rating range, placing players in the Light Blue and Blue tiers, which roughly translates to the former Gold Nova to early Master Guardian ranks in CS:GO. A large chunk of players (around 37-65%) are clustered in the 10k-20k range, with ratings above 20k becoming increasingly rare, marking truly elite skill.

What Elo is Grandmaster?

In chess, a Grandmaster (GM) title generally requires a FIDE Elo rating of 2500 or higher, though players also need to achieve specific performance levels (norms) in tournaments, making it about skill demonstrated over time, not just a single rating number. While 2500 is the benchmark, some top GMs reach ratings well over 2600, sometimes called "super grandmasters," and players retain the title even if their rating temporarily drops below 2500, says this Chess.com forum post.

What is a good KD in CS2?

A good K/D (Kills/Deaths) in CS2 is generally considered anything above 1.0, with 1.2-1.6 being very good, and 2.0+ being exceptional, but it heavily depends on the game mode, rank (Elo), and if you're playing with a team versus solo, as truly high K/D can sometimes mean playing below your skill level or focusing less on objectives. For most players in balanced matches, maintaining a K/D above 1.0 shows you're winning more fights than you're losing.

How good is 25k elo CS2?

CS2 Premier Rating
  • Grey: 0 to 4999.
  • Cyan: 5000 to 9999.
  • Blue: 10000 to 14999.
  • Purple: 15000 to 19999.
  • Pink: 20000 to 24999.
  • Red: 25000 to 29999.
  • Gold: 30000 to Unlimited.

What is the 20-40-40 rule in chess?

The 20-40-40 rule in chess is a suggestion for how to divide your study time if you are a beginner or an intermediate player. It means that you should spend 20% of your time learning the opening, 40% of your time practicing the middlegame, and 40% of your time studying the endgame.
